Big Two Toyota Salary

As of August 2026, the average hourly salary for employees at Big Two Toyota in the United States is $32.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$66,981. Salaries at Big Two Toyota typically range from $28 to $37 hourly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Chandler?

Understanding the cost of living near Chandler is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Big Two Toyota.
Chandler's Cost of Living Index is approximately 109.8 (9.8% more expensive than US average; 6.4% more than AZ average). Affluent Phoenix suburb, driven by higher housing costs and general goods/services. Tech hub influence.
